Repairing Composite Door Chips


Repairing chips in composite doors is usually a simple procedure. Below are various methods to think about, depending on the severity of the chip:

1. Minor Chips and Scratches

Products Needed:

Actions:

  1. Clean the Area: Use a tidy cloth to get rid of any dust or grime around the chip.
  2. Sand the Chip: Gently sand the chipped location utilizing medium grit sandpaper, followed by fine grit, to smooth the edges.
  3. Apply Touch-Up Paint: Use the paint touch-up package to fill the chip. Be sure to follow the maker's instructions.
  4. Seal the Area: Once the paint has dried, use a clear coat sealant to secure the location.

2. Moderate Chips

For chips that are much deeper or larger, a more comprehensive repair process might be required.

Products Needed:

Steps:

  1. Clean the Area: Start with a tidy surface.
  2. Fill the Chip: Apply the filler according to the product guidelines. Permit it to cure.
  3. Sand Smooth: Once cured, sand the area till it is flush with the door surface.
  4. Paint and Seal: Follow the very same painting and sealing procedures similar to minor chips.

Maintenance Tips to Prevent Chips


Preventive care is important to keeping the stability of composite doors. Here are some tips to think about:

  1. Regular Cleaning: Clean with a moderate cleaning agent to prevent buildup.
  2. Avoid Impact: Be mindful of high-traffic locations to reduce unexpected knocks.
  3. Sealant Application: Regularly check and reapply sealant as needed to safeguard the surface.
  4. Professional Inspections: Schedule yearly assessments to look for prospective problems.

Frequently Asked Question About Composite Door Chip Repair


Q1: Can I repair a chip myself, or should I hire a professional?

A: Minor and moderate chips can often be fixed yourself with the right products. Nevertheless, for comprehensive damage, it's finest to consult a professional.

Q2: What if I can't find a coordinating paint color?

Q3: How long does the repair procedure take?

A: Minor repairs can typically be completed in a few hours. Nevertheless, drying times for paint and sealants can extend the total time to a complete day.

Q4: Will fixed chips affect the guarantee of my composite door?

A: Most warranties cover producing defects but might not cover damage due to incorrect handling. Always examine the guarantee specifics before making repairs.

Q5: How can I prevent chips from happening in the very first place?

A: Regular maintenance, cautious handling, and protecting the door from extreme weather condition can considerably decrease the likelihood of chips.
